How do I fix my keyboard on Windows 8?

Locate and double-click on Keyboards, then right-click on your keyboard and click Uninstall device. Wait until the uninstall finishes and Restart your computer so that your computer can auto-install the keyboard driver. Type on your laptop keyboard again and see if it works properly.

How do I find Windows keyboard settings?

To access keyboard settings in Windows, follow the steps below.

  1. Open the Control Panel.
  2. Find and click, or double-click, the Keyboard icon. If you’re not viewing the Control Panel as icons, change the View by to Large or Small icons in the top-right corner of the Control Panel.

How do I enable my keyboard on Windows 8?

Select “Control Panel.” In the Control Panel window, click “Ease of Access,” click “Ease of Access Center,” and then click “Start On-Screen Keyboard.” You can pin the keyboard to your taskbar to access it more easily in the future, if you like. You can also access the on-screen keyboard on Windows 8’s sign-in screen.

How do I unlock my keyboard?

How to Fix a Keyboard That’s Locked

  1. Restart your computer.
  2. Turn off Filter Keys.
  3. Try your keyboard with a different computer.
  4. If using a wireless keyboard, replace the batteries.
  5. Clean your keyboard.
  6. Check your keyboard for physical damage.
  7. Check your keyboard connection.
  8. Update or reinstall the device drivers.

How do I fix my keyboard settings?

Go to Settings > Update & Security > select Troubleshoot. Locate the keyboard troubleshooter and run it. After the scan, follow the troubleshooting instructions on the screen. Restart your computer and check if the problem persists.

Why are my keyboard symbols mixed up?

If you press Alt+Shift, you get a little popup that allows you to switch the keyboard language. Alternatively, go to the System Tray area and click ENG then set the keyboard language—the one highlighted in black is the active one.

How do I open keyboard settings?

To open it, press Windows + R on your keyboard, type the command ms-settings: and click OK or press Enter on your keyboard. The Settings app is opened instantly.

How to set keyboard to default settings?

Right-click the Start menu and then choose Device Manager from the context menu to open it.

  • Click Keyboards to expand it and then find the keyboard device you want to reset.
  • Right-click it and then choose Uninstall device.
  • Click Uninstall from the pop-up window to confirm uninstalling the chosen keyboard.
  • How do I Change my Microsoft keyboard settings?

    Click Start and then Control Panel. In Control Panel , if you are in Classic View, click on Control Panel Home (top left corner) Open Clock, Language, and Region. Click on Regional and Language Options. Click the Keyboards and Languages tab and then click Change keyboards.

    How do you change the default keyboard settings?

    1. Open Settings, and click/tap on the Devices icon. 2. Click/tap on Typing on the left side, and click/tap on the Advanced keyboard settings link on the right side under More keyboard settings. (see screenshot below) 3. Select the keyboard layout you want as default in the Override for default input method drop menu.

    How do you turn on touch keyboard?

    Here’s how you can turn on the touch keyboard in Microsoft’s Windows 8 operating system. 1. Right click the taskbar. 2. Go to Toolbars. 3. Click on Touch Keyboard. 4. Choose the keyboard icon on the bottom right of the taskbar to use the following options: Full-screen mode Thumb mode Pen mode.
